Output e3043e0393d7f2faaf84ee21ace91e537d9814684beccbeaa4a33493b61541eb:0

value
698526
script pubkey
OP_0 OP_PUSHBYTES_20 8c5835aacc04b28c118a1047056e1e6b661f74dc
address
bc1q33vrt2kvqjegcyv2zprs2ms7ddnp7axufv59lq
transaction
e3043e0393d7f2faaf84ee21ace91e537d9814684beccbeaa4a33493b61541eb
spent
true